Common LiftMaster Garage Door Problems We Solve in Dacula
- 3280 travel module and plastic drive gear failure. The 3280’s original drive gears crack from age and humidity after 15–20 years of daily cycles. In Hamilton Mill and surrounding planned communities, these were installed by the hundreds during the 2000s build-out — we’re now seeing concentrated failures across entire streets.
- 8400-series wall-mount capacitor failure. Summer storms in Dacula push humidity through unsealed wiring ports on 8500W and 8400 units, frying control board capacitors. We’ve replaced dozens of these after July thunderstorms roll through Gwinnett County.
- 8160W torsion spring snap at 20–25 years. Original springs on 8160W-equipped doors were spec’d identically across whole subdivisions. When one goes on your street, your neighbor’s aren’t far behind. We spotted this pattern early and stock high-cycle 25,000-cycle replacement springs rated for Dacula’s thermal cycling.
- Remote signal loss from logic board degradation. The 3280’s receiver board weakens over time, especially in uninsulated garages that hit 95°F+ in August. We carry OEM replacement boards and can test signal strength on-site.
- Bottom seal bonding and track misalignment from freeze-thaw. Dacula’s hard freezes — often arriving overnight with no warning — bond rubber seals to concrete slabs. Homeowners who force the door open bend tracks and stress openers. We realign tracks and upgrade to cold-flexible seal profiles.

LiftMaster Models & Products We Service in Dacula
We stock and service the full LiftMaster residential lineup, with particular depth on the units most common in Dacula’s 30019 ZIP:
- LiftMaster 3280 — Belt-drive workhorse of the 2000s build-out. We carry OEM drive gears, logic boards, and capacitor kits for this series; aftermarket gears fail too quickly in Georgia humidity to recommend.
- LiftMaster 8160W — DC chain-drive unit with MyQ compatibility, standard on many 2003–2008 Dacula builds. We stock replacement chains, sprockets, and wall-button assemblies.
- LiftMaster 8500W — Wall-mount jackshaft opener, ideal for low-headroom retrofits in older Dacula homes where ceiling clearance is tight. We handle full installs and smart-home integration.
- LiftMaster Professional Series 1/2 HP — The builder-grade standard. We repair and replace these units, though we often recommend upgrading to an 8160W or 8500W when the original hits 20+ years.

Yes — the 8500W mounts beside the door, freeing ceiling space and eliminating the rail assembly. In Dacula’s 1970s–1980s ranch stock and some tight garage conversions, this is often the only way to get modern opener performance without structural modification. We handle full 8500W installs including MyQ setup and battery backup.
